Winscombe is a pretty village in Somerset, near Axbridge and Cheddar. It lies within the Mendip Hills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. In the village centre, you will find tearooms, a cosy pub, a wine shop and a small grocery. On the doorstep of holiday cottages in Winscombe, scenic walks can be enjoyed through the rugged limestone hills. The region is dotted with ancient caves, the most famous of which is Wookey Hole, where an intricate network of pools and stunning rock formations can be explored. Nearby, Cheddar Gorge cuts a deep gash through the Mendip Hills. A small road runs through the gorge, providing incredible views of this geological phenomenon. Beneath the gorge, you can visit the Cheddar Caves, which were carved by underground rivers during the Ice Age. A few miles from your holiday cottage in Winscombe, ascend the 274 steps of Jacob’s Ladder to a clifftop viewpoint towards Glastonbury Tor, Exmoor, and the Bristol Channel beyond. The charming resort of Weston-super-Mare is a short drive from Winscombe, with a sandy beach, a pier, and plenty of seaside amusements. The city of Bristol is just a short drive northward from Winscombe, with impressive architecture, excellent shopping, and many of the region’s best places to eat and drink.
